C# Класс Malt.Reporting.VelocityTextTemplateEngine

Наследование: ITextTemplateEngine
Показать файл Открыть проект

Открытые методы

Метод Описание
Evaluate ( object>.IDictionary context, TextReader input, TextWriter output ) : void
RegisterFilter ( Type t, IRenderFilter filter ) : void
Reset ( ) : void
VelocityTextTemplateEngine ( string logTag ) : System

Приватные методы

Метод Описание
CreateVelocityContext ( object>.IDictionary context ) : VelocityContext
DoFilter ( NVelocity.App.Events.ReferenceInsertionEventArgs e ) : void
OnReferenceInsertion ( object sender, NVelocity.App.Events.ReferenceInsertionEventArgs e ) : void

Описание методов

Evaluate() публичный Метод

public Evaluate ( object>.IDictionary context, TextReader input, TextWriter output ) : void
context object>.IDictionary
input TextReader
output System.IO.TextWriter
Результат void

RegisterFilter() публичный Метод

public RegisterFilter ( Type t, IRenderFilter filter ) : void
t System.Type
filter IRenderFilter
Результат void

Reset() публичный Метод

public Reset ( ) : void
Результат void

VelocityTextTemplateEngine() публичный Метод

public VelocityTextTemplateEngine ( string logTag ) : System
logTag string
Результат System